Transaction 6a96836bbebd20a98c043bd41f0d50c60e31cf5d28b78dd371aa0e98925914d8
1 Input
1 Output
-
6a96836bbebd20a98c043bd41f0d50c60e31cf5d28b78dd371aa0e98925914d8:0
- value
- 8638450
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f88c0e949f97de91f2a2dd77ed2fc427cdd5ff84 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PfCMuJfAynvkrUABr9qRkAxcbRsTKTrwn